Jul 16, 1929 – Jan 7, 2025 (Age 95)
Ted J. Theodore, age 95 (and a half!), fell peacefully asleep in the Lord on January 7, 2025 after a beautiful, robust, vibrant and extraordinary life. Ted, the artist supreme, the sports enthusiast, the determined runner, the championer of all those striving for greatness, and supporter and...

Ted was my art teacher from 8th grade to 12th grade at Berea High school for 5 yrs. I then found out that he and my dad both had horse and milk wagon routes for Producers Milk. He one time took a painting I had been playing around with and sent it to an art show and it won a 1st prize. Over the years he and Irene too were always so encouraging about everything in life. May he rest in peace. He and Irene will both be missed at many class reunions.
